#6dbee5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6dbee5 is composed of 42.7% red, 74.5%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.4% cyan, 17%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 199.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 66.3%. #6dbee5 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#007dcb.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6dbee5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6dbee5 has RGB values of R:109, G:190,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 7192293.

Shades and Tints of #6dbee5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fd is the lightest one.
